Output 89c98e2b9996199db82b7524c7d39d8146a8a8a86ef3d81d6cd68c7116885824:1

value
1360519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 130a90e90ca43c96f71d39a9d0392275e9a17116 OP_EQUAL
address
33RhRL9fAbVzmk5NBEC4ZE6qjiAq51C7bL
transaction
89c98e2b9996199db82b7524c7d39d8146a8a8a86ef3d81d6cd68c7116885824
confirmations
322475
spent
true